Index: include/stdlib.h
===================================================================
--- include/stdlib.h
+++ include/stdlib.h
@@ -295,8 +295,8 @@
#endif
int mkostemp(char *, int);
int mkostemps(char *, int, int);
-void qsort_r(void *, size_t, size_t, void *,
- int (*)(void *, const void *, const void *));
+void qsort_r(void *, size_t, size_t,
+ int (*)(const void *, const void *, void *), void *);
int radixsort(const unsigned char **, int, const unsigned char *,
unsigned);
void *reallocarray(void *, size_t, size_t) __result_use_check __alloc_size(2)
@@ -309,7 +309,18 @@
void sranddev(void);
void srandomdev(void);
long long
- strtonum(const char *, long long, long long, const char **);
+ strtonum(const char *, long long, long long, const char **);
+
+/* Legacy BSD-style qsort_r compatibility shim */
+#if __GNUC_PREREQ__(3, 1) && !defined(__cplusplus)
+typedef int (__old_qsort_cmp_t)(void *, const void *, const void *);
+void __old_qsort_r(void *, size_t, size_t, void *, __old_qsort_cmp_t *);
+__sym_compat(qsort_r, __old_qsort_r, FBSD_1.0);
+#define qsort_r(base, nmemb, size, A, B) \
+ __builtin_choose_expr( \
+ __builtin_types_compatible_p(__typeof(B), __old_qsort_cmp_t), \
+ __old_qsort_r, qsort_r)(base, nmemb, size, A, B)
+#endif
/* Deprecated interfaces, to be removed in FreeBSD 6.0. */
__int64_t

Index: lib/libc/stdlib/qsort.3
===================================================================
--- lib/libc/stdlib/qsort.3
+++ lib/libc/stdlib/qsort.3
@@ -32,7 +32,7 @@
.\" @(#)qsort.3 8.1 (Berkeley) 6/4/93
.\" $FreeBSD$
.\"
-.Dd February 20, 2013
+.Dd January 13, 2017
.Dt QSORT 3
.Os
.Sh NAME
@@ -61,8 +61,8 @@
.Fa "void *base"
.Fa "size_t nmemb"
.Fa "size_t size"
+.Fa "int \*[lp]*compar\*[rp]\*[lp]const void *, const void *, void *\*[rp]"
.Fa "void *thunk"
-.Fa "int \*[lp]*compar\*[rp]\*[lp]void *, const void *, const void *\*[rp]"
.Fc
.Ft int
.Fo heapsort
@@ -142,7 +142,7 @@
.Fn qsort ,
except that it takes an additional argument,
.Fa thunk ,
-which is passed unchanged as the first argument to function pointed to
+which is passed unchanged as the final argument to the function
.Fa compar .
This allows the comparison function to access additional
data without using global variables, and thus
@@ -161,8 +161,9 @@
.Fn heapsort
are
.Em not
-stable, that is, if two members compare as equal, their order in
-the sorted array is undefined.
+stable.
+That is, if two members compare as equal, their order in the sorted
+array is undefined.
The
.Fn heapsort_b
function behaves identically to
Index: lib/libc/stdlib/qsort.c
===================================================================
--- lib/libc/stdlib/qsort.c
+++ lib/libc/stdlib/qsort.c
@@ -35,8 +35,10 @@
#include <stdlib.h>
-#ifdef I_AM_QSORT_R
+#if defined(I_AM_QSORT_R)
typedef int cmp_t(void *, const void *, const void *);
+#elif defined(I_AM_GLIBC_QSORT_R)
+typedef int cmp_t(const void *, const void *, void *);
#else
typedef int cmp_t(const void *, const void *);
#endif
@@ -89,15 +91,17 @@
#define vecswap(a, b, n) \
if ((n) > 0) swapfunc(a, b, n, swaptype_long, swaptype_int)
-#ifdef I_AM_QSORT_R
+#if defined(I_AM_QSORT_R)
#define CMP(t, x, y) (cmp((t), (x), (y)))
+#elif defined(I_AM_GLIBC_QSORT_R)
+#define CMP(t, x, y) (cmp((x), (y), (t)))
#else
#define CMP(t, x, y) (cmp((x), (y)))
#endif
static inline char *
med3(char *a, char *b, char *c, cmp_t *cmp, void *thunk
-#ifndef I_AM_QSORT_R
+#if !defined(I_AM_QSORT_R) && !defined(I_AM_GLIBC_QSORT_R)
__unused
#endif
)
@@ -107,9 +111,12 @@
:(CMP(thunk, b, c) > 0 ? b : (CMP(thunk, a, c) < 0 ? a : c ));
}
-#ifdef I_AM_QSORT_R
+#if defined(I_AM_QSORT_R)
void
-qsort_r(void *a, size_t n, size_t es, void *thunk, cmp_t *cmp)
+__freebsd11_qsort_r(void *a, size_t n, size_t es, void *thunk, cmp_t *cmp)
+#elif defined(I_AM_GLIBC_QSORT_R)
+void
+(qsort_r)(void *a, size_t n, size_t es, cmp_t *cmp, void *thunk)
#else
#define thunk NULL
void
@@ -187,8 +194,10 @@
r = MIN(pd - pc, pn - pd - es);
vecswap(pb, pn - r, r);
if ((r = pb - pa) > es)
-#ifdef I_AM_QSORT_R
- qsort_r(a, r / es, es, thunk, cmp);
+#if defined(I_AM_QSORT_R)
+ __freebsd11_qsort_r(a, r / es, es, thunk, cmp);
+#elif defined(I_AM_GLIBC_QSORT_R)
+ (qsort_r)(a, r / es, es, cmp, thunk);
#else
qsort(a, r / es, es, cmp);
#endif
@@ -200,3 +209,7 @@
}
/* qsort(pn - r, r / es, es, cmp);*/
}
+
+#if defined(I_AM_QSORT_R)
+__sym_compat(dirname, __freebsd11_qsort_r, FBSD_1.0);
+#endif
